MK Single TV socket Gloss White
Product details
Product information
This gloss plastic raised screwed screwed coaxial socket is ideal for use with a TV and satellite's (internal use only).
- Guarantee - 20 years
- Only fittings included
Features and benefits
- Raised slim profile
- Screwed faceplate
- Requires a 25mm back box
- Backed-out captive terminal screws

Rhinocerant - 5 / 5 - 17/12/2020
Good with a useful angle
Good MK quality, and the angle of the socket is a much better idea than the usual perpendicular ones. If the coax core is too small for the spring connection, then just bend it over double and it clips in just fine, sorry if that’s a bit obvious.

- 1 / 5 - 10/03/2017
Not good
As above, the connection for the central core wire is not good. I only got half the channels available against wiring the aerial lead directly to the back of the tuner. I will be looking for a proper screw fitting for both wires rather than a push fit.

engineerbob - 2 / 5 - 11/03/2013
Not as good as it looks
After fitting this I had signal drop outs. This is because the spring which holds the centre core is not strong enough. Some coax cables may be OK. MK make top notch stuff but this and the two way version fall short. I swapped for a screw type one which works fine.
